    *A FRIENDLY DISCLAIMER TO ALL*

    A quick reminder that TOD is pretty much like a full weekend of going to the track, which means making sure that the car is in top mechanical, electronic, etc, condition. Make sure everything is up to par, and there are no compromises made. A 500+ mile towing bill will definitely put a dent in anyone's budget. SO have your car checked up prior to leaving.

    "Long Ball Rally and all parties involved in the organization of this event are in no way shape or form liable for any speeding tickets, accidents, damage to cars, bodies, personal relationships, brain cells or accidental conceptions that may occur over the course of this trip. You are joining this cruise/rally to TOD/Wookies in the Woods 2012 of your own free will and here by agree that you are a consenting adult of legal age and are to be held accountable for your own actions, however stupid they may be."

    >>>That being said, don't be an a$$hat. Cruise speeds will be give or take around the speed limit.
    There will be NO racing, reckless driving, or excessive speeding tolerated. If you can't understand this or violate the posted warning, you may be asked to break off from the group and continue separately on your own.

    Just thought I'd mention this as well:

    A few peeps, no one on here, have been keen to mentioning and grumble a bit about the fact that this is a 12-13hr trip to TOD, when in fact they claim it to be a 10hr trip at most.

    YES, it is a 10hr trip, but only if you go with a few cars at most. And what people fail to realize is that with 10-15+ cars plus it realistically does take the extra few hours. From fuel stops, to food stops, to gathering everyone up and getting on the road, it just does.
